如何使用MySQL数据库创建角色 [英] How to create role with MySQL database
本文介绍了如何使用MySQL数据库创建角色的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
是否可以在MySQL中使用CREATE ROLE
?
Is there a way to use CREATE ROLE
with MySQL?
可以使用PostgreSQL创建角色,但是当我尝试使用MySQL时,它会返回以下错误消息:
It's possible to create roles with PostgreSQL but when I try with MySQL it returns this error message:
#1064-您的SQL语法有错误;检查与您的MySQL服务器版本相对应的手册以获取正确的语法,以在第1行的角色家族"附近使用
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'role famille' at line 1
推荐答案
MySQL 5没有角色(如果您要寻找与MySQL兼容的RDBMS(即MariaDB). MariaDB具有MySQL缺乏的基于角色的访问控制,并且是开源的.
If you would be looking for RDBMS that is compatible with MySQL that would be MariaDB. MariaDB has Role-based access control that MySQL lacks and is open-source.
这篇关于如何使用MySQL数据库创建角色的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文